DCI Reveals Items Seized from Kware Killings Suspect: Includes Multiple Phones, Machete, and Sacks

The Directorate of Criminal Investigations (DCI) has revealed that the prime suspect behind bodies discovered in Kware, Mukuru Slums, Nairobi, murdered 42 women.

The Directorate of Criminal Investigations (DCI) has unveiled a disturbing array of items seized from the prime suspect in the Kware killings, shedding light on the gruesome nature of the crimes.

According to DCI boss Mohamed Amin, the suspect, Collins Jomaisi Khalisia has confessed to the murder of 42 women over a span of two years, their bodies callously disposed of at the Kware dumpsite.

During a press briefing, DCI boss Mohamed Amin disclosed the inventory recovered from the suspect’s possession, which includes 24 sim cards, 8 smartphones, 2 feature phones, a laptop, a hard drive, 2 flash drives, a memory card, a machete suspected to have been used in dismemberment, 12 nylon sacks similar to those used to conceal the victims’ bodies, industrial rubber gloves, and various personal items belonging to the victims.

“The items recovered are crucial to our investigation into this heinous series of murders,” Amin stated, emphasizing the meticulous nature of the forensic examination underway.

The victims, whose murders span from 2022 to as recently as July 11, 2024, were all allegedly subjected to similar methods of disposal.

Amin further detailed that the suspect’s first victim was reportedly his wife, whom he accused of financial mismanagement.

“The suspect alleged that the first victim was his wife, whom he strangled to death, dismembered, and dumped at the site,” Amin disclosed, painting a picture of a deeply troubled individual driven by vengeance and hatred.

“We are dealing with a psychopathic serial killer who shows no regard for human life,” Amin remarked, highlighting the gravity of the case that has sent shockwaves through the community.
